Welsh Black reigns champion at Kington show  

Despite the scorching heat, exhibitors were not deterred from the show ring at Kington.  

Supreme champion of the day across all livestock sections was the Welsh Black champion, Aur Du Bombay Sapphire which won any other native champion and inter-breed beef champion under judge Thomas Corbett,...
